Conceptually there's big overlap between SMBIOS and fwcfg, as they are
both data tables exposed by firmware at well defined location/format.
Currently we have use SMBIOS via
<sysinfo type='smbios'>
...SMBIOS info...
</sysinfo>
It feels sensible to use that "type" attribute
<sysinfo type='fwcfg'>
...fwcfg info...
</sysinfo>
